After the passage of National Security Law in Hong Kong, the citizens and foreign nationals express their concern regarding human right violations. Counter to this situation, Canada offers three new pathways for the residents of Hong Kong to immigrate to Canada.

The first pathway comprising of an Open work Permit Stream will be launched on February 08, 2021 whereas, the rest two pathways one for permanent residence applicants and one for study permit applicants will be taken into consideration in the months ahead.

Exploring the details regarding these pathways –

 

  • Open work permit program for recent graduates

Honk Kong residents who have been in Canada or abroad may apply for an open work permit which will be valid for 3 months. The applicant is supposed to have completed a post-secondary diploma or degree under a minimum of two years program. If the program has not been pursued from a Canadian institute, you will be expected to submit the educational credentials equivalent to Canadian degree at the time of application. Another important aspect that needs to be taken care of is the course/ program must have been completed within 5 years of submitting the application. Hong Kong residents currently in Canada will be allowed to submit an online application under this pathway.

 

  • IEC Working Holiday Program

Among major 30 countries bound under the IEC (International Experience Canada) program in Canada, Hong Kong is the one that has a Working Holiday agreement with Canada. This agreement allows professionals from foreign countries to live and work in Canada up to 2 years. The foreign nationals under this program have the privilege to travel to another country while sourcing employments of their chosen field usually between 12-24 months.   • Express Entry

Express Entry, introduced in 2015, is a pathway to immigrate to Canada and obtain permanent residence. It is available for citizens of Hong Kong as well as the other countries. This system accepts the applications of eligible candidates and gives them rank based on their age, education, language proficiency, work experience and other factors.

 

New Pathways expected in 2021

Moreover, for Hong Kong residents who are already staying in Canada and wish to apply for a PR, the eligibility has been defined as –

  1. Possessing Work Permit – must have at least 1 year of Canadian work experience and meet a minimum language and education requirement.
  2. Possessing Study Permit – must have graduated from a post-secondary institution in Canada.

Furthermore, Canada is stepping forward to introduce several measures and initiatives to favor the Hong Kong youth, which includes elimination of certain documents for immigration applications, relinquishing certain application fees and more.
